1947 Omega Jumbo in 38,5mm

This 1947 Omega Jumbo presents the oversized 38,5mm case that distinguished post‑war dress watches seeking a bolder wrist presence. The watch’s proportions and jumbo styling reflect a transitional era in watch design when legibility and scaled‑up cases became desirable. At the heart sits Omega’s Cal. 265, part of the 30T2 family, a respected manual‑wind movement known for robust construction and straightforward serviceability. For the contemporary collector, such a piece offers a direct link to mid‑century manufacturing and movement architecture, appreciated for its historical context and mechanical character.
